30,000 CHILDREN TO BE SAVED BY NEW VACCINE ANNUALLY - MIMIKO
 
By:
Thu, 4 Jul 2013   ||   Nigeria,
 

As much as 30,000 children below the age of one would be saved annually ,  Ondo state governor, Olusegun Mimiko, has said, stating that he introduction of the pentavalent vaccine in the state would put an end to the menace of Haemophilus Influenza b related death.

Speaking at the inauguration of the pentavalent vaccine in the state, the governor expressed the commitment of his administration to the complete eradication of polio and other children related diseases in the state and further commented like he always did that government was committed to the continuous sensitization of the public on polio eradication initiative, routine immunization and all maternal and child health programme.

The governor also pointed out that the inauguration of the pentavalent vaccine was sequel to the approval from GAVI to introduce the Haemophilus Influenza b antigen as a pentavalent vaccine in a phased manner into its EPI schedule.

However, the governor e urged the people for complete acceptance and mobilization of the new pentavalent vaccine in the state

Mimiko further urged all the local government caretaker committee chairmen to provide necessary supports for the introduction of pentavalent vaccine in all health facilities offering routine immunization in their respective councils.
